Fresh Herbal Aroma Classification

Fresh herbal aroma classification groups cannabis strains characterized by bright, green, plant-forward volatile profiles often featuring notes of grass, mint, basil, or oregano. These aromatic compounds typically derive from terpenes like myrcene, limonene, and pinene, which create olfactory impressions reminiscent of culinary herbs or crushed vegetation. Lineage records frequently report fresh herbal aromatics in strains descended from landrace or heirloom genetics, particularly those with Southeast Asian or Mediterranean heritage. This classification remains distinct from floral, fruity, or spice-forward categories, though overlap occurs in complex phenotypes. Fresh herbal strains are commonly encountered across hybrid and sativa-dominant breeding populations.

Breeder relevance

Breeders working with fresh herbal genetics often select for these terpene profiles to establish distinctive sensory markers or preserve historical landrace characteristics. The trait appears relatively stable across generations when parent selection maintains myrcene and pinene expression.
